Output 3ddf5625e22fa5b9a37a999461b24bd93f8bf3a9e043df101793e39c5e6c82c5:0

value
306176073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5434b4cb4e480acb6b3ddb6291b2d5bfd48341f OP_EQUALVERIFY OP_CHECKSIG
address
1MuEMcG52HdpnsKE2qhb2GXqhuymTq6G4U
transaction
3ddf5625e22fa5b9a37a999461b24bd93f8bf3a9e043df101793e39c5e6c82c5
spent
true